amorphous sky

A state of the sky, characterized by an abundance of fractus clouds, usually accompanied by precipitation falling from a higher, overcast cloud layer. It is termed “amorphous” because the clouds lack any distinctive form (bands, undulations, clear-cut base, etc. ).
